Mafia Misplay Mafia

Setup: 12 Vanilla Townies, 3 Mafia Goons.

Deadlines: 48 hour days, 24 hour nights. The thread is closed during the night phase. Days/nights end at 8PM EST.

Special rules: Appeals to emotion that do not violate site rules are permitted. Speculating into the alignment-indicative nature of replacements is permitted. Speculating into the alignment-indicative nature of people's online statuses is permitted. No other forms of angleshooting are permitted. If you are uncertain if something is permitted, contact me. Game rules:
1) None of you know your flavor except the mafia. Anyone who says they do is either lying or mafia. Your flavor will be revealed upon death.

2) The vote in the poll is the official vote. Any votes in-thread will be disregarded in favor of the vote in the poll. You do not have to vote in-thread when you make a vote in the poll; as per the theme of the game, it is the responsibility of the players to hold you accountable for any shenanigans.

3) There are no hammers. At EOD, the player with the most votes will be eliminated.

4) If there is a tie between two players at EOD, nobody will be executed. Remember, this game's theme is mafia misplays and how to hold them accountable. Don't let ties happen or you will suffer the consequences.

5) You can vote sleep if you want. Mafia have to kill each night; if they do not, the kill will be randed. I prefer to let the mafia no-kill, but in this case it leads to weird situations where neither alignment wants to kill someone at F4.

6) There is no postcap. There is no minimum post requirement. The game's theme is mafia misplays and holding them accountable... so players are responsible for holding lowposters accountable. Or finding them town off the 2 posts they made and clearing them anyway. Props to you if you can do that.

7) Do not falsely concede the game in thread. I am a very lenient host this game, but I don't want to have to deal with this shit and for some reason it has been gaining popularity lately. If you try to concede or pretend to concede, I will immediately replace you out regardless of your alignment. You can still concede in private, and you can still discuss concessions (eg. "if the wolf team were so and so, they would have conceded already"), but you may not publicly concede or pretend to concede.

8) I won't bother you with the rest of the standard stuff about not talking outside of the game thread or editing posts. You guys are all experienced mafia players. You know how this works. If you want to do anything remotely sketchy that isn't explicitly permitted, ask me first.
